1984 Isuzu Piazza vs. 2004 Mercedes-Benz C
To start off, 2004 Mercedes-Benz C is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Isuzu Piazza.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Isuzu Piazza would be higher. At 2,597 cc (6 cylinders), 2004 Mercedes-Benz C is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Mercedes-Benz C (160 HP @ 4200 RPM) has 12 more horse power than 1984 Isuzu Piazza. (148 HP @ 5400 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Mercedes-Benz C should accelerate faster than 1984 Isuzu Piazza.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Mercedes-Benz C weights approximately 360 kg more than 1984 Isuzu Piazza.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2004 Mercedes-Benz C (240 Nm) has 14 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 Isuzu Piazza. (226 Nm). This means 2004 Mercedes-Benz C will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 Isuzu Piazza.
